I haven't seen anyone answer this yet, so I'll let you know how I'm doing it :P

I currently have a 32 GB SDHC card in that exact same adapter with this setup:

Wii Swiss Booter located in:
./apps/Swiss/boot.dol

swiss-0.1-r7 located in:
./apps/Swiss/swiss.dol

The only two games I've ripped so far:
./Gamecube/GZLE01.iso
./Gamecube/GALE01.iso

(Melee and Wind Waker, respectively. Both working perfectly :P)

Make sure you have a CMIOS installed first, I got the one linked here
Then I just go to homebrew channel, select SDGecko Slot B, and load swiss


edit: I've updated to using the Wii channel forwarder found here
This is the setup on my hdd:
./apps/Swiss/boot.dol
./apps/Swiss/swiss.dol

The games are still located on the SDHC card in the adapter in slot B

New in svn revision 17:
- Fixed Zelda CE Windwaker demo (pre-patcher issue)
- Fixed Zelda Master Quest
- Changed relative branching to direct branching (mtctr,bctrl) (fixed 007 Everything or nothing)
- Possibly more titles fixed - please test :)
- Fixed broken ide-exi code
- Swiss now checks the version a game was pre-patched with
